Overview of the Sciences Research Administrative Service Center

The Science Research Administration Service Center represents a more evolved model for research administration to better address the continuous challenges presented by sponsored research, especially with an accelerated growth in sponsored research well above our current capacity. This model was based on developing a life-cycle team to administer grants from “cradle to grave.” This team is composed of both pre-award and post-award specialists who work together and support a common customer: the principal investigator. In this model, both the pre-award and post-award specialists work in the same physical location, have the same client portfolios and are jointly responsible for the same set of deliverables. This presents a model where both pre- and post-award specialists can meet with the principal investigator together to resolve any grants management issues.
